Output 63b90a232de6b6a9647b96517226867b55e3ba21e9bf222f393d6bea5b1ac4d1:0

value
389705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21ca7c52edb80e3db4e7f11984fc89cd5f0c33d5 OP_EQUAL
address
34mgnph9o8Gav7GowLKjas1cjjjhk8twq1
transaction
63b90a232de6b6a9647b96517226867b55e3ba21e9bf222f393d6bea5b1ac4d1
spent
true